Output 25d86819b9bec4ca90197fa05bdbd7b1f2dbb1423c962669a74eabae65679c6f:1

value
129900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c50840cda08bd7fe0369853689ac9a77866edf OP_EQUAL
address
3LdbqHvafSeGrt2ZWMoMf6DSNy8XeoGYKt
transaction
25d86819b9bec4ca90197fa05bdbd7b1f2dbb1423c962669a74eabae65679c6f
spent
true